Transaction c62e3888e99f5667ff07b7d7f5b7e7f8abc731ac1e1e124ef61f0f1164200a97

1 Input
2 Outputs
  • c62e3888e99f5667ff07b7d7f5b7e7f8abc731ac1e1e124ef61f0f1164200a97:0
  • value  2168404
    address  39CEdfNFsQqWwR5JuEbgcAfBo4SAfFuB2z
  • c62e3888e99f5667ff07b7d7f5b7e7f8abc731ac1e1e124ef61f0f1164200a97:1
  • value  1798562
    address  38RCbvxgGF6H2kJaV6ZjhmiVAG6RXpueCS